Хабр Курсы для всех
РЕКЛАМА
Практикум, Хекслет, SkyPro, авторские курсы — собрали всех и попросили скидки. Осталось выбрать!
if (!length!=3) doSomething();
not length!=3 and doSomething()подобных минусов не имеет
if (length == 3) Плохие же пишут код, которому недостаёт концептуальной целостности, лаконичности, иерархичности, шаблонов проектирования, и его невероятно сложно рефакторить.
Проще выбросить плохой код на помойку и начать заново, чем что-то менять в нём.
программисты думают о работе 24 часа 7 дней в неделю

Программист тратит 10-20% своего времени на написание собственно кода, и большинство программистов пишут всего 10-12 строк кода в день, которые попадают в конечный продукт, независимо от их уровня.
Хороший программист в 10 раз более продуктивен, чем средний. Отличный программист в 20-100 раз более продуктивен, чем средний.
Некоторые малоизвестные факты о программировании